I owned the Icurve. Hated it. I own the expensive Searto stand. It's wobbly but easily portable into a foam case that fits in a normal sized recrod bag. I'd travel to gigs with doe to the portablility. The odyssey is the strongest and can be used to fit 3 different applications. [tabletop/clamped on horizontal or vertital planes] It DOESN'T fit back into it's foam container without the use of a screwdriver (& 4 itty bitty shitty screws) The foam case will not fit in a record bag unless it is oversized.
Pick your poison.

First off - The Serato stand will not be a good solution. I do not know for sure about the L stand + the cases. I'm about to be in your boat shortly, since I'm going to be getting an odyssey coffin case and probably another another odyssey stand. I'm pretty sure that the clamp of the stand will be ok for the job.
Take a look at the PDF, (from the odyssey link) find part #9. This part has 2 holes in it and is screwed in to the base section #4 (bottom right - this part has 4 holes in it). The #9 part can be rotated 90 degress counter clockwise and screwed in to #4 - creating a clamp that can be afixed to a vertical plane. This is the reason I believe you will not have an issue attaching it to a case... My uncertainty lies in the amount of support this mount will afford and if I want to support an expensive laptop in this fashion.
